Following int he footsteps of Jamie Staff, British rider Liam Phillips will be making the switch into the world of velodromes and track bikes. In a statement released by British Cycling, Phillips stated “Over the past few years, I’ve sustained numerous injuries which have left me unable to train on the BMX track for significant periods of time…. Turning to track has meant that I receive a solid block of training with opportunities to compete at a high level which means I’m not missing out on the competition experience.” For more info and the full release check out British Cycling.
